Issue

  • We need to load a module for restricting IP accesses from certain places. We need to enable "ngx_http_geoip_module" to achieve this behavior.
  • If we set the directive "load_module modules/ngx_http_geoip_module.so;" into liferay.conf file we get the following error
    "load_module" directive is not allowed here in /etc/nginx/conf.d/liferay.conf:1

Environment

  • Liferay PaaS, Liferay DXP 7.2 with stack 5.x

Resolution

  • In order to load modules in nginx you have to modify either nginx.conf, or add a new config file in below path:
    /webserver/config/{env}/myfile.conf
    This way, the load_module directive will be correctly processed and the module will be loaded into your webserver service.
